Termanology and Ed Rock aka Ea$y Money sit down for an interview as they prepare the S.T.R.E.E.T. album before Ed Rock gets locked up for 18 months. Termanology and Ea$y Money discuss the meaning of S.T.R.E.E.T. and ST. Da Squad, both in the past and current state. Termanology speaks on Ea$y Money’s ability to write songs at an incredibly rapid rate, and the motive behind the S.T.R.E.E.T. album. Ea$y Money’s first single off the S.T.R.E.E.T. album is Wait For Me, produced by Lee Bannon. Catch a clip of the single at the end of the interview.
Its too bad to see Ea$y Money get locked up for some time. From the various times I’ve met and spoke with him, he’s a humble dude who is incredibly talented on the mic. Wait For Me has that sound, and worst case scenario, the underground hip hop fans in Mass will definitely be anticipating this album. I have a feeling it will spread far beyond just Massachusetts though.
